Hybrid models for decision-making based on rough Pythagorean fuzzy bipolar soft information

A Pythagorean fuzzy set model is a powerful tool for depicting fuzziness and uncertainty. In this paper, the notions of two novel hybrid models, namely Pythagorean fuzzy bipolar soft set model and rough Pythagorean fuzzy bipolar soft set model are introduced. The Pythagorean fuzzy bipolar soft set is the generalization of different hybrid models including bipolar soft set, fuzzy bipolar soft set and the Pythagorean fuzzy soft set. Our developed concepts are illustrated by examples. Some useful basic properties and operations of the hybrid models are investigated. In particular, multiattribute decision-making problems with numerical examples are solved by our new hybrid models. An algorithm of each approach is developed.
